Italy has become a trend in the first collection of the new brand Femea Milano, which made Italy the principal subject of it.



The fusion of the ideas and the great experience of the manager Luca Cantele and the architect Fabiana Scrudato gave life to a collection of bags completely focused on bringing out the wonder of the Italian land, thus succeeding in binding art and fashion into a single product.

Two years of hard working on looking for high quality and perfection in every detail allowed the brand to promote a type of leather bag with classic and essential lines, embellished by a particular bas-relief made with marble powder travertine in which is depicted a glimpse of an Italian city: Rome, Venice and Milan were the cities chosen by the creators, who decided to recreate respectively Piazza di Spagna, the Rialto Bridge and Piazza Duomo.Femea Milano: Italy as a trendThe sculptures represented on bags are made entirely by hand by master craftsmen, who paint them creating the chiaroscuro effect typical of marble, and also accomplishing an exceptional workmanship that makes the bas-reliefs lighter than the normal weight of the material, in order to simplify the use of bags.

A further peculiarity of Femea Milano’s superlative products is the top quality leather that makes them; the bags are also available in small, medium and large sizes, in the two classic black and white colors, which are perfect to match every outfit and every style.Femea Milano: Italy as a trendThe first collection of Femea Milano is therefore a good omen for the future of the brand, which has highlighted two very important and often neglected aspects about Italy: the excellence of the craftsmanship and the beauty of its cities. It has also created an innovative, elegant and luxurious product, which will surely succeed in being appreciated in the world of fashion.
